Here are the essential units for a Global Certificate in Contract Modification: High-Performance Strategies:

• Contract Modification Basics: Understanding the fundamentals of contract modification, including the reasons for modification, types of modifications, and legal requirements.

• Change Management Strategies: Implementing effective change management strategies to ensure successful contract modification, including communication, stakeholder management, and risk assessment.

• Negotiation Techniques: Utilizing advanced negotiation techniques to achieve favorable contract modifications, including preparation, communication, and concession strategies.

• Contract Drafting and Review: Drafting and reviewing contract modifications with a focus on clarity, accuracy, and legal compliance.

• Dispute Resolution: Addressing disputes arising from contract modifications, including negotiation, mediation, and litigation strategies.

• Global Contract Modification Practices: Understanding global best practices for contract modification, including cultural considerations, legal differences, and industry standards.

• Technology and Contract Modification: Utilizing technology to streamline contract modification processes, including contract management software, automation, and artificial intelligence.

• Continuous Improvement: Implementing continuous improvement strategies for contract modification, including performance metrics, process optimization, and stakeholder feedback.

Contract Manager (40%): Contract managers play a crucial role in overseeing the entire contract lifecycle, from initiation to closure. They ensure compliance, mitigate risks, and facilitate communication between all parties involved. 2. Contract Specialist (30%): Contract specialists focus on specific aspects of the contract management process, such as drafting, reviewing, and negotiating contracts. Their expertise often lies in identifying potential issues and ensuring contractual obligations are met. 3. Contract Negotiator (20%): Contract negotiators are responsible for establishing the terms and conditions of a contract. They work closely with stakeholders to reach mutually beneficial agreements that align with organizational objectives. 4. Contract Analyst (10%): Contract analysts review, interpret, and analyze contracts to ensure compliance and identify potential risks. Their role is essential in managing contract lifecycle costs and maintaining positive relationships with contractual partners.
